Enhancement of compression and compaction properties of calcium carbonate powder by granulation with HPC, HPMC and sodium- alginate as binders for pharmaceutical applications: an optimization case study.

Deeb Abu Fara, Iyad Rashid, Linda Hmoud, Shatha Al-Qatamin, Babur Z Chowdhry, Adnan A Badwan,
